Basic calculations used for all sun time calculation algorithms (though currently only the NOAA algorithm is used)

Constants§

EARTH_RADIUS
The commonly used average earth radius in KM
GEOMETRIC_ZENITH
90° below the vertical. Used as a basis for most calculations since the location of the sun is 90° below the vertical at sunrise and sunset.
REFRACTION
34 arcminutes of refraction
SOLAR_RADIUS
16 arcminutes for the sun’s radius in the sky

Functions§

adjusted_zenith
Adjusts the zenith of astronomical sunrise and sunset to account for solar refraction, solar radius and elevation.
elevation_adjustment
Function to return the adjustment to the zenith required to account for the elevation.
